What is the difference between a 4-star and 3-star hotel in Madrid?
The key difference between a 3- and 4-star hotel in Madrid is the standard of service and access to creature comforts. Three-star hotels are generally lower priced and provide the amenities and services you need to be comfortable, such as a gym, breakfast and WiFi. You can expect a bit more at a 4-star hotel — think upmarket interiors, deluxe toiletries and extras like on-site day spas.
